Kevin Shaw: The Streets Stop Here, The Bob Hurley Sr. Story
In this episode we welcome one of the finest storytellers in the non-fiction space, Kevin Shaw. Kevin has won multiple Emmy Awards and the Edward R. Murrow Award for Sports Reporting Excellence, for a feature that he produced for the Big10 Network. Kevin most recently worked alongside documentary legend Steve James on America To Me, which debuted at Sundance and is lauded as one of the greatest docu-series of all time. Aaron Cohen: When New York Was One, The 2000 Subway Series
A living legend in the world of sports media, Aaron Cohen has won 30 National Sports Emmys and a record nine Dick Schaap Writing Awards. Cohen has helped produced some of the most iconic stories in sports, including HBO’s Boxing and Hockey docuseries "24/7", NBC’s Olympic Games Coverage, "The Fab 5", "Magic and Bird: A courtship of rivals", and "McEnroe Borg: Fire and Ice". Sarah Moshman: Losing Sight Of Shore
On today’s show we welcome Sarah Moshman, Emmy Award winning filmmaker, TedX Speaker, and now a working Mom with 2 beautiful children. A champion of female empowerment, Sarah has focused her documentary career on shining a light on impressive women starting with The Empowerment Project, Ordinary Women Doing Extraordinary Things, and then she followed that film up with the documentary that we will discuss today, Losing Sight of Shore, where a small team of women rowed across the Pacific. Billy Corben: The U
In this episode, we welcome documentary legend Billy Corben. As a college student at the Univeristy of Miami, Billy was the youngest director to ever premiere at Sundance with his film Raw Deal: A Question of Consent. Billy followed that up with Cocaine Cowboys, Miami’s real life version of Scarface, which electrified viewers worldwide. With his foothold on the Magic City, Billy documented his alma mater’s footall dynasty, The U, for ESPN’s 30 for 30.
